The Winners


Athens' Got Talent GRAND PRIZE: Jennifer Snipes

Jennifer Cornelius Snipes is the Grand Prize winner of the Women to the World's first ATHENS' GOT TALENT Competition. Jennifer is the mother of four, and teaches Math at County Line Elementary School in Barrow county, with more than seventy-five students, in Second and Fourth grades. Jennifer's strong contralto voice was clear and country, as she performed, “Walkin' After Midnight.” With high points from the judges, Jennifer was able to obtain votes from her fans right up to the night of the performance. Women to the World congratulates Jennifer Cornelius Snipes for her exceptional role in this first annual talent competition.

ATHENS CHOICE:
1st-Adnan (The King) Curry, 2nd-Hope Dalton, 3rd-Greg Varner

VARIETY:
1st-Tori O'Bryant, 2nd-Rachel Holland & Spencer Smith, 3rd-Jam Session

ADULT:
1st-Jennifer Snipes, 2nd-Shantisa Coleman, 3rd-Sabrina Porterfield

YOUTH:
1st-Pushtee Jhaveri, 2nd-Sean Van Meter, 3rd-Sylvia Lee Walker
